The amount of compensation you receive from the VA is based on your disability rating which is a percentage that is based on the extent to which your condition interferes in your ability to work and perform everyday tasks. The higher your rating is, the more money you are able to earn. A veteran disability lawyer can assist in obtaining the medical records needed to get a high rating and secure your right to TDIU benefits.

A qualified disability lawyer can also offer advice on whether you're eligible for military special credits, which can increase your Social Security income. These are credits based on the type of service you've rendered to the country and could be an important element of your claim for disability. A professional can assist with appeals that are normally required in the event of a negative response from the VA. They can assist you in filing an appeals notice, as well as representing you in hearings before decision review officers and veterans law judges.
